Output d27e953111291fc6720e30c1bba2fa0fbf7fc36351f782ce7b6c2f45ff492d1b:25

value
406579200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2448dcb537813b0f39c9f55d50675d6b14030aa8 OP_EQUAL
address
MBD1qtMstf4agcMY6knHscTsCLkeaweZjN
transaction
d27e953111291fc6720e30c1bba2fa0fbf7fc36351f782ce7b6c2f45ff492d1b
spent
true